hi, @krallin It has been more than two years since the last version, what is the version plan? Is it possible to release a new version with some bug fixes or new features?

krallin commented 1 year ago

The short answer is that Tini seeks to be a minimal init system, so I’m not particularly keen to add more and more features and I wouldn’t see that as a success over time (though people are welcome to use to use forks).

I’m not aware of any bugs in the currently released version. If some were found, then I’d certainly make a new release, yes.
